Brendan P. Riordan: Accused of Sexual Misconduct

Brendan P. Riordan

In 1995, the Diocese of Worcester settled a child sexual abuse lawsuit which named Fr. Brendan P. Riordan. Fr. Riordan was the Director of Education at the House of Affirmation in the Massachusetts Diocese of Worcester when he allegedly sexually abused a boy there.

Fr. Brendan P. Riordan was ordained a priest for the Diocese of Rockville Centre in 1970 and worked at the following locations:

  • 1970-1975: St. Aloysius, Great Neck, NY
  • 1975-1984: St. Pius X Prep Seminary, Uniondale, NY (in residence from 1978 to 1984)
  • 1982-1984: St. James, Seaford, NY (Temporary Administrator)
  • 1984-1986: House of Affirmation, Boston [sic], MA (Director of Education)
  • 1986-1988: St. Kilian, Farmingdale, NY
  • 1989-1998: SS. Cyril & Methodius, Deer Park, NY
  • 1998-2007: St. Aloysius, Great Neck, NY

Fr. Brendan P. Riordan served on the board of Community Organization for Parents and Youth (COPAY), a Long Island nonprofit that counsels’ drug addicted teens. COPAY denies any current affiliation. Fr. Riordan is believed to be residing in West Palm Beach, Florida.
